How is this different from a meditation app?
BAM is biometrically aware. It knows when your heart rate jumped as you mentioned something tender, and gently mirrors that back. Other apps offer content libraries. BAM offers a feedback loop — your body becomes part of the conversation.
What techniques does BAM use in Therapy mode?
Somatic inquiry, affect labeling (name-it-to-tame-it), pendulation between activation and calm, resourcing, and cognitive reframing — drawing on the somatic-experiencing and CBT traditions. The AI companion is trained to ask more than it tells, and to validate before suggesting techniques.

Is my voice stored?
No. Voice audio is streamed to OpenAI Realtime API for real-time processing using short-lived ephemeral session credentials. Audio is not retained on our servers and is not used to train models.
How long is a typical Therapy session?
5 to 15 minutes is typical. BAM tracks the session and offers a closing recap that summarizes your physiological journey across the session.
Will BAM tell me what I am feeling?
It offers 1 or 2 emotion labels for what you describe and asks if any fit. You stay in the driver seat. BAM never tells you what you are feeling — it offers language and waits to see what lands.
What if my biometrics spike during a hard moment?
BAM down-regulates first. Before any cognitive work, the companion offers a grounding breath or resourcing pause. Safety is the priority — insight follows.
